Identity and Release History

In 2017, the world of perfumery was enriched by a new creation from the legendary Lalique, which immediately caught the attention of connoisseurs of exquisite fragrances.

The unisex perfume Deux Cigales, known in Russia as "Two Cicadas," became part of the elegant Noir Premier collection, reflecting the brand's deep connection with art and luxury.

This release symbolizes the bold combination of tradition and innovation characteristic of Lalique, whose history began with crystal masterpieces and continues in the world of fragrances, where each bottle is a work of art.

Deux Cigales is an eau de parfum, released in 2017, making it relatively young but already having gained recognition among niche perfume enthusiasts.

Its name, inspired by Mediterranean cicadas, hints at the summer lightness and natural harmony it embodies.

The fragrance belongs to the Floral and Oriental families, promising a rich and multifaceted sound, perfectly suited for modern connoisseurs seeking versatility and depth.

Authors and Influence

Behind the creation of this impressive fragrance is the talented perfumer Richard Ibanez, known for his ability to combine classical elements with modern accents.

His work on Deux Cigales demonstrates a deep understanding of olfactory art, allowing him to harmoniously weave Oriental and floral motifs into a single composition.

This release strengthened the reputation of Lalique as a brand that is not afraid to experiment, while maintaining a commitment to quality and aesthetics, making it a significant contribution to the world of niche perfumery.

Description of the composition

The fragrance pyramid of Deux Cigales begins with a refreshing start, where lavender and pink pepper (red berries) create a spicy-green accord that instantly invigorates and draws attention.

In the heart of the fragrance, a floral symphony unfolds with heliotrope, rose, and tuberose, adding tenderness and depth that smoothly transition into a warm base.

The final notes include amber, sandalwood, tonka beans, vanilla, and white cedar, creating a cozy and long-lasting sillage that leaves behind an intriguing trail.

The persistence of a fragrance is determined by how long it can be felt. It is a characteristic associated with ingredients that evaporate slowly. Persistence depends on the physical properties of the perfume ingredients—mainly their volatility and environmental factors such as temperature and humidity.

Sillage
Imagine a light cloud of fragrance that, like an aeroplane trail, remains in the air after your appearance. This is the sillage - a subtle or vivid imprint left by the most diffuse element of a perfume composition. The sillage can be almost invisible when it is felt only by you and those around you. Or it can be so expressive that its presence is noticed even long after you have left.

The bottle, sure, looks pretty good, even kinda sparkles in the light, but that doesn't save the situation. The scent? That's a whole different story. Lavender and spicy herbs, yeah, that's an acquired taste, but the pepper here is definitely too much. The rose, yeah, it's mature, but not in a good way. The sweet vanilla base, that's okay, but the sweetness here feels kinda out of place. Powdery, yeah, but I can't say it's like, super amazing. Out of the whole line, I probably like this one the most, but even with the rose, things aren't that smooth. In the drydown, it sometimes gives off something old and unpleasant
